The Mechanics Behind the Silence
Redditors who are technically inclined often break down why some fans are whisper-quiet while others are disruptive. The primary culprit of noise is usually the motor; a high-quality, brushless DC motor (ECM) is frequently cited as the gold standard for silent operation. Unlike traditional AC motors, these smaller, more efficient units generate significantly less vibration and heat. Furthermore, the design of the blades and the overall airflow dynamics play a crucial role. Fans designed with aerodynamic, curved blades tend to slice through the air rather than pushing it, resulting in a smooth rush of air that is inherently quieter than the choppy, turbulent flow produced by boxy, generic blades.

Navigating the Trade-Offs
However, the pursuit of a completely silent fan on Reddit isn't without its debates. Users often have to weigh the need for silence against the need for power. A fan that is whisper-quiet on its lowest setting might not provide enough circulation on a sweltering 90-degree night. This leads to discussions about "acceptable noise" versus "performance." Many users recommend looking for models with a high Air Circulation to Noise ratio, meaning they can move a lot of air on a mid-setting while still remaining relatively hushed on a low setting. It is about finding the sweet spot between a gentle whisper and a powerful gale.
